    What is a small solar panel?

    A small solar panel is usually designed not to be used on an extensive home solar system but for other uses. Most involve charging batteries to power small appliances and devices. Because they are smaller, they often have a harder wearing frame and may have an adaptation to make them more portable.

    How much power can a small solar panel generate?

    2. How much power can a small solar panel generate Small solar panels can generate between 10W and 100W, depending on the size you choose. If you have a 5W compact panel, you can use it to charge small devices like smartphones or an LED bulb.

    Do solar panels damage your roof?

    While solar panels themselves will not inherently damage your roof, an improper installation can lead to problems down the line. It is crucial to ensure that the installation is done correctly by a professional, or with thorough research and proper planning if you choose to do it yourself.

    Do solar panels need a slanted roof?

    You have to position solar panels properly to achieve the highest energy production. The optimal orientation and angle usually require a slanted roof that faces the sun. Some roofs have a unique shape that might not accommodate rigid, flat panels. For those homes, flexible solar panels can be a good workaround.

    What is peak power in solar panels?

    kWp. Peak Power in Solar Panels is defined by the metric KILOWATT PEAK: kWp. kWp represents the theoretical peak output of the system, used as a measure to compare one system against another. It is the headline metric used to indicate the size of a Solar Installation.

    How many kilowatts does a solar PV system produce?

    Total capacity of the solar PV system represented in terms of kilowatt peak power output (kWp). A solar system with a peak power rating of 3.68kWp working at its maximum capacity on a sunny day will produce 3.68kW of electricity. The orientation of the proposed solar PV system (s) in relation to true south.

    What does kWp mean on a solar panel?

    Put simply, kWp is the peak power capability of a solar panel or solar system. The manufacturer gives all solar panels a kWp rating, which indicates the amount of energy a panel can produce at its peak performance, such as in the afternoon of a clear, sunny day.

    How many kilowatt-hours a kWp solar system produces?

    A different output is achieved for one kWp of solar panels depending on the PV system's region and its sunlight conditions. Therefore, on the roof of a house in Brussels, a one kWp installation will produce 900 kilowatt-hours (kWh) per year. It is calculated under optimal conditions: south orientation, 35° angle.
